What is Chemical Waterproofing?
Chemical waterproofing involves using liquid or powdered chemical compounds to create a water-resistant barrier on surfaces such as concrete, metal, or brick. These chemicals react with substrates to block pores and micro-cracks, preventing water penetration.
Common formats include:
Coatings
Admixtures
Sealants
Grouts
Membranes infused with chemicals

Types of Chemical Waterproofing Solutions
a) Crystalline Waterproofing
These chemicals penetrate concrete and react to form crystals that block water paths.
b) Bituminous Coatings (Modified with Chemicals)
Used on foundations and roofs; provides durable, flexible coverage.
c) Polyurethane Liquid Membrane
Forms a seamless and highly elastic waterproof coating.
d) Acrylic Waterproofing Systems
Used for terraces and external walls.
e) Cementitious Coatings
Economical and effective for internal wet areas like bathrooms.
f) Epoxy Waterproofing
Best for industrial floors and areas with chemical exposure.
g) Silane/Siloxane Water Repellents
Ideal for masonry and facade protection.
Advantages of Chemical Waterproofing
Penetrative & Deep Action: Seals micro-pores and capillaries
Versatile: Works on walls, slabs, rooftops, basements, etc.
Seamless: No joints or laps
Cost-Effective: Long lifespan and low maintenance
UV-Resistant: Suitable for exposed surfaces
Quick Installation: Many products are single-component, ready-to-use
